Technical Specifications & Selection Guide

Use the table below to confirm system compatibility before ordering. The complete model number must be specified on all purchase orders to ensure correct configuration.

Specification Value
Full Model Number PR6423/10R-030+CON021
Sensor Tip Diameter 8 mm
Thread Standard 3/8″-24 UNF (Unified National Fine)
Mount Configuration Reverse Mount (R)
Case Thread Length 55 mm (030 suffix)
Cable Length 8 meters, PTFE insulated
Connector Type Lemo self-locking
Linear Measurement Range 2.0 mm (80 mils)
Optimal Initial Gap 0.5 mm (20 mils)
Scale Factor (ISF) 8 V/mm ± 5% (0-45°C)
System Bandwidth DC to 20,000 Hz ( 3 dB)
Linearity Error ±1% full range
Sensor Operating Temp. 35°C to +180°C
Converter Operating Temp. 30°C to +100°C
Sensor Protection Rating IP66 (IEC 60529)
Converter Protection Rating IP20
Supply Voltage 21 VDC to 32 VDC
Sensor Housing Material 316 Stainless Steel
Sensor Tip Material PEEK
Compliance Standards API 670, ISO 20816, ISO 7919, CE, RoHS
Condition 100% Original and Brand New, Factory Sealed

Selection Note: The “R” suffix denotes reverse mount — confirm your bracket accommodates rear-entry installation. For standard forward-mount applications, specify PR6423/10S-030+CON021. For non-ferromagnetic target materials (stainless steel, aluminum), request custom calibration at time of order.

Typical Application Scenarios

✅ Oil & Gas — Centrifugal Compressor Protection
Thrust bearing wear and rotor instability are leading causes of unplanned shutdowns in gas processing facilities. The PR6423/10R-030+CON021 monitors axial shaft position with sub-millimeter resolution, enabling SIS trip logic to activate before catastrophic bearing failure. The reverse-mount configuration solves the chronic problem of insufficient clearance around compressor bearing housings on offshore platforms.

Power Plants — Steam & Gas Turbine Vibration Monitoring
API 670-compliant XY proximity probe pairs installed at each bearing location feed shaft orbit data to the plant DCS. The CON021’s 20 kHz bandwidth captures blade-pass frequencies and sub-synchronous instabilities that narrower-band systems miss, enabling early detection of rotor dynamic problems during startup and load transients.

✅ Petrochemical — Reactor Agitator Shaft Monitoring
High-viscosity process fluids impose unpredictable radial loads on agitator shafts. Continuous eddy current monitoring detects progressive bearing degradation and shaft deflection before seal failure introduces process contamination. The IP66 sensor rating ensures reliable operation in wash-down environments with aggressive cleaning chemicals.

✅ Heavy Industry — Large Generator Rotor Eccentricity
Foundation settlement and magnetic center shifts in large generators manifest as slowly increasing rotor eccentricity. The DC response of the CON021 converter tracks these quasi-static position changes over hours and days, providing early warning that allows planned maintenance outages rather than emergency repairs.

✅ Marine & Offshore — Propulsion Shaft Monitoring
The 316 stainless steel housing and IP66 rating make this system suitable for the corrosive, high-humidity environment of marine engine rooms. The 8-meter cable accommodates routing from shaft tunnel sensor locations to remote signal conditioning panels.

Q5: What target materials are compatible with the PR6423/10R-030 sensor?
A: The standard factory calibration is optimized for ferromagnetic steel targets (42CrMo4 / AISI 4140). For non-ferromagnetic materials — including 316 stainless steel, Inconel, titanium, or aluminum — a custom calibration is required and must be specified at time of order. Minimum shaft diameter is 25 mm to avoid curvature-induced linearity errors. Surface roughness should be Ra < 3.2 μm for optimal measurement performance.

Q6: Does the PR6423/10R-030+CON021 meet ATEX / IECEx requirements for hazardous area installation?
A: The standard PR6423/10R-030+CON021 is not intrinsically safe rated for Zone 0/1 hazardous areas. For ATEX/IECEx Zone 1 or Zone 2 installations, the system must be used in conjunction with a certified Zener barrier or galvanic isolator (e.g., MTL or Pepperl+Fuchs IS barriers).
